			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="http://www.m-bike.org/blog/wp-content/uploads/2010/12/bike-crashes-2005-2009-heat-map.jpg"><img style=' float: right; padding: 4px; margin: 0 0 2px 7px;'  class="alignright size-medium wp-image-5177" title="Metro Detroit bicycle-vehicle crashes" src="http://www.m-bike.org/blog/wp-content/uploads/2010/12/bike-crashes-2005-2009-heat-map-282x300.jpg" alt="" width="282" height="300" /></a>While doing some preliminary work with <a title="Google Fusion" href="http://www.google.com/fusiontables" target="_blank">Google Fusion Tables</a>, we created this very basic heat map showing the locations of bicycle-motor vehicle crashes throughout the Metro Detroit region (Oakland, Wayne, Macomb, and St. Clair counties.)</p>
<p>The map does not weight the crashes based on the severity of the injury. Green dots indicate one crash, while orange and red indicate multiple crashes in the same vicinity.</p>
<p>What&#8217;s interesting is the distribution. Detroit has noticeably fewer hot spots compared with the surrounding communities.</p>
<p>And some roads have enough crashes that they pop out on the map. That&#8217;s true of Gratiot through Macomb County, and to a lessor extent, Woodward through Oakland County.</p>

<p>On Wednesday at 54-year old male cyclist was hit and killed by a motorist when she drove off the road in <a title="Sterling Heights" href="http://www.macombdaily.com/articles/2010/11/23/news/doc4ceb302c9e808479336179.txt?viewmode=fullstory" target="_blank">Michigan&#8217;s &#8220;safest city&#8221;, Sterling Heights</a>.</p>
<p><a title="Fox 2 News" href="http://www.myfoxdetroit.com/dpp/news/local/man-riding-bike-in-sterling-heights-killed-in-accident-20101201-wpms" target="_blank">Fox 2 News reports</a>:</p>
<p style="padding-left: 30px;">Police say <strong>Julia Werth</strong> was traveling eastbound on 18 Mile between Mound and Ryan when she dropped something in her car. When she went to pick it up, she allegedly veered off the road and struck a 54-year-old man, who happened to be riding his bike on the gravel shoulder just a few feet ahead.</p>
<p style="padding-left: 30px;">FOX 2 has learned Werth, the woman accused in this fatal accident, is 20 years old. We found out she has twelve points on her driving record for two alcohol violations, two speeding tickets and a car accident.</p>
<p style="padding-left: 30px;">It is not clear if Werth will face any criminal charges.</p>
<p>The <a title="Macomb Daily" href="http://www.macombdaily.com/articles/2010/12/03/news/doc4cf877fb73871138807371.txt?viewmode=fullstory" target="_blank">Macomb Daily is reporting</a> that charges have not been filed as of today.</p>
<p>No, 18 Mile is not a Complete Street though facilities such as bike lanes don&#8217;t prevent bad drivers from killing others. In this case, the victim was apparently riding on the gravel shoulder. <a href="http://www.completestreets.org/">Complete Streets</a> can make bicyclists more visible to drivers, but whether that would have helped in this case is merely speculation</p>
<p>One frustrating sideline to this story? <strong>Sterling Heights Police Lt. Dale Dwojakowski</strong> told the  the <a title="Free Press" href="http://www.freep.com/article/20101202/NEWS04/101202035/1320/Driver-looks-away-kills-Sterling-Hgts.-bicyclist" target="_blank">Detroit Free Press</a>:</p>
<p style="padding-left: 30px;">“A bicycle can ride on the roadway and they do have all the rights a car would have,” he said. “Unfortunately, he wasn’t on the roadway, he was on a gravel shoulder. And even more unfortunate, there was a brand new sidewalk just installed about 15 feet from where he was riding.”</p>
<p>Perhaps it wasn&#8217;t the Lieutenant&#8217;s intent but it sounds like he would like to see cyclists on sidewalks. Fox 2 News echoed his comment as well.</p>
<p>At least they didn&#8217;t say it was &#8220;even more unfortunate&#8221; that he couldn&#8217;t afford a car.</p>
<p>The bottom line focus needs to be on the driver, who had a very poor driving record at a young age and apparently hadn&#8217;t learned from prior mistakes.</p>
<p>There is a Prosecute Julia Werth page on Facebook that has now grown to 203 people. <strong>UPDATE 12/6/2010: Facebook removed the original page. The replacement page is <a title="Facebook" href="http://www.facebook.com/pages/Justice-for-Jim-Sawicki/166331466735299?ref=ts&amp;v=wall" target="_blank">Justice for Jim Sawicki</a>.</strong></p>
<p><strong>And if you have any tips regarding this crash, please call the Sterling Heights police at (586) 446-2892.</strong></p>
<p>This is not the first bicyclist to be killed in Sterling Heights this year. This summer<a title="Macomb Daily" href="http://www.macombdaily.com/articles/2010/06/25/news/doc4c236f8923f3d846144954.txt" target="_blank"> two motorists hit and killed a cyclist</a>. The first motorist fled the crash scene.</p>
<p>In 2009 a cyclist was killed in Sterling Heights , as were two more in 2006.</p>
<p>From 2004 through 2009, there Sterling Heights averaged 0.40 bicyclist fatalities per 100,000 residents. These 2010 deaths will raise that rate significantly, making it much more than double the entire state of Michigan&#8217;s rate of 0.23 bicyclist fatalities per 100,000 residents. (The city of Detroit rate is 0.27.)</p>
<p><strong>Clearly Sterling Heights isn&#8217;t Michigan&#8217;s safest city for bicycling &#8212; and that is most unfortunate.</strong></p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>From the <a title="Detroit News" href="http://www.detnews.com/article/20100726/METRO02/7260378/1409/Man-on-bike-dies-in-hit-and-run-crash-in-Farmington-Hills" target="_blank">Detroit News</a>:</p>
<p style="padding-left: 30px;">Police are looking for a black sports car today they believe was involved in a fatal hit-and-run crash Sunday night on Middle Belt Road.</p>
<p style="padding-left: 30px;">Police said Redford Township resident John Sallman was riding his bicycle southbound on Middle Belt between Nine and 10 Mile roads when he was struck by a speeding car at about 10:45 p.m.</p>
<p style="padding-left: 30px;">A witness told police he was proceeding southbound on Middle Belt when he was passed by a Pontiac G6 driving at a high rate of speed. The driver said the Pontiac then returned to the southbound lane in front of the witness and then struck Sallman, 44.</p>
<p style="padding-left: 30px;">The driver of the Pontiac failed to stop and fled the scene.</p>
<p style="padding-left: 30px;">Police believe the suspect vehicle may have damage to the front end as well as the windshield.</p>
<p style="padding-left: 30px;">Anyone with information is asked to call the traffic safety section of the Farmington Hills Police Department at (248) 871-2630. After 4:30 p.m., call (248) 871-2610.</p>
<p>Middlebelt is not a Complete Street, just like most of the streets in Farmington Hills. This city&#8217;s attempt at bike friendliness is a short bike lane on one side of a road.</p>
<p>After reading their planning documents, it&#8217;s fairly clear that bicycles are for recreation and not transportation.</p>
<p>Many times there master plan (produced by Vilican Leman &amp; Associates) states &#8220;Bike paths and/or sidewalks are installed to provide non-motorized access throughout the area.&#8221; Saying &#8220;bike paths and/or sidewalks&#8221; means either someone doesn&#8217;t understand <a href="http://www.transportation.org/">AASHTO</a> bicycle design guidelines or <a href="http://www.completestreets.org/">Complete Streets</a> principles.</p>
<p>Sadly enough, Oakland County Planning and Economic Development Services <a title="Oakland County PEDS" href="http://www.oakgov.com/peds/program_service/luz_prgm/mp_review.html" target="_blank">reviewed this master plan</a> and their staff &#8220;commended&#8221; Farmington Hills.</p>
<p>And the city&#8217;s sustainability report (produced by Hooker De Jong) is downright delusional: &#8220;Farmington Hills will continue to develop as a community that is livable, walkable, bikeable, culturally interesting and safe.&#8221;</p>
<p>Bikeable and safe? Where?</p>
<p>Certainly not on Middle Belt &#8212; and that&#8217;s how they planned it.</p>

<p>The title is misleading. Other road users, including cyclists can report potholes &#8212; not just motorists.</p>
<p>As you may know, <a title="MDOT" href="http://www.michigan.gov/mdot/0,1607,7-151-9615_30883-93194--,00.html" target="_blank">MDOT has a reimbursement program</a> if one of these potholes damages your vehicle. According to a <a title="Velonews" href="http://velonews.competitor.com/2004/11/news/legally-speaking-with-bob-mionske-rough-roads-ahead_7191" target="_blank">2004 VeloNews article</a>, Michigan bicyclists should be able to make claims as well. The MDOT claim forms are not specific to motorists.</p>
<p>Still, getting reimbursed is not easy <a title="MDOT" href="http://www.michigan.gov/mdot/0,1607,7-151-9615_30883-93194--,00.html" target="_blank">according to MDOT</a>.</p>
<p style="padding-left: 30px;">The state will consider an award only for the damages beyond what has been paid by your insurance company, and the state must have been aware of the pothole for 30 days without repairing it in order for a claim to be eligible for reimbursement.</p>
<p>Also note that parts of that VeloNews article are outdated due to more recent court decisions.</p>
<p>A 2006 court case determined that by law, counties and MDOT are only liable for vehicular travel lanes.</p>
<div id="_mcePaste" style="padding-left: 30px;">&#8220;The duty extends only to the improved portion of the highway designed for vehicular travel and does not include sidewalks, trail ways, crosswalks, or any other installation outside of the improved portion of the highway designed for vehicular travel&#8230;&#8221;</div>
<div id="_mcePaste" style="padding-left: 30px;">Grimes v MDOT (2006)</div>
<p>It also doesn&#8217;t include paved shoulders or bike lanes &#8212; bikes are not vehicles under Michigan law. On one hand, that&#8217;s good for convincing road agencies to build bike facilities (no added liability.) However, that also means cyclists are not afforded the same protections as motorists.</p>
<p>According to the state attorney general&#8217;s office, the liability extends beyond potholes to include:</p>
<ul>
<li>Rutting</li>
<li>Manhole covers</li>
<li>Dilapidated road surface</li>
<li>Traveled (vehicle) lane edge drops</li>
<li>Missing storm sewer grates</li>
</ul>
<p>Either way, it&#8217;s imperative that cyclists keep a keen eye on the road conditions this time year until the patching crews can get some repairs made.</p>

<p>Michael Eckert, a 50-year old cyclist and assistant managing editor of the Times Herald was struck in a hit-and-run in St. Clair County.</p>
<p>According to an <a title="Times Herald" href="http://www.thetimesherald.com/article/20090107/NEWS05/90107002" target="_blank">article in the Times Herald</a>:</p>
<p style="padding-left: 30px;">Police said the vehicle involved is believed to be a mid-sized, purple Pontiac that may have damage to the passenger side front door. The driver is believed to have fled the scene of the accident north on Pollina Road.</p>
<p style="padding-left: 30px;">Eckert&#8217;s wife, Theresa, said a man found Eckert lying by the side of the road and called 911. She said one of Eckert&#8217;s shoes was found 200 feet from his bike.</p>
<p style="padding-left: 30px;">Eckert sustained multiple broken ribs, a broken clavicle, a collapsed lung and there was a problem with the vertebrae in his neck. Eckert was able to speak, however, Theresa Eckert said.</p>
<p>According to one commenter on the Times Herald web site, Eckert rode with lights on his bike: &#8220;He does wear red led flashers and a headlight while riding, See him every night.&#8221;</p>
